The city of Arkham is a nexus for the strange, the dangerous, and the supernatural. In this adventure book, you’ll face some of the different dangers that threaten the city to give you a glimpse of the infinite possibilities offered to game masters by the Arkham Horror RPG Core Rulebook:
- Stop would-be arcanists who have gained too much power
- Find the cause behind people falling into bizarre comas
- Investigate the mysterious death of a graduate student at the Miskatonic MuseumThese three unique stand-alone adventures are designed for beginner level investigators. Each adventure is a different length (6 to 13 scenes per adventure), but most scenes are designed for about an hour of playtime to fit into any schedule. Now is the time to make your own characters and experience the thrill of unraveling the truth and stopping disaster!
- THREE STANDALONE ADVENTURES: Investigate the supernatural and uncover dark secrets in three unique scenarios set in the eerie city of Arkham.
- IMMERSIVE STORY-DRIVEN GAMEPLAY: Stop rogue arcanists, solve bizarre comas, and investigate a mysterious murder at the Miskatonic Museum.
- DESIGNED FOR GAME MASTERS & PLAYERS: Each adventure is tailored for beginner-level investigators, offering 6-13 scenes per story for flexible session lengths.
- INCLUDES NPC PROFILES & POSTER MAPS: Features unique character profiles for streamlined gameplay and two double-sided poster maps for visual immersion.
- BONUS PDF DOWNLOAD: A unique code inside grants access to a free digital version via DriveThruRPG for easy online reference.

Anime Grading Guide
'Near Mint (NM)'
Near Mint condition cards show minimal or no wear from play or handling and will have an unmarked surface, crisp corners, and otherwise pristine edges outside of minimal handling. Near Mint condition cards appear 'fresh out of the pack,' with edges and surfaces virtually free from all flaws. '
'
'Lightly Played (LP)'
Lightly Played condition cards can have slight border or corner wear, or possibly minor scratches. No major defects are present, and there are less than 4 total flaws on the card. Lightly Played condition foils may have slight fading or indications of wear on the card face. '
'
'Moderately Played (MP)'
Moderately Played condition cards have moderate wear, or flaws apparent to the naked eye. Moderately Played condition cards can show moderate border wear, mild corner wear, water damage, scratches , creases or fading, light dirt buildup, or any combination of these defects. '
'
'Heavily Played (HP)'
Heavily Played condition cards exhibit signs of heavy wear. Heavily Played condition cards may include cards that have significant creasing, folding, severe water damage, heavy whitening, heavy border wear, and /or tearing. '
'
'Damaged (D)'
Damaged condition cards show obvious tears, bends, or creases that could make the card illegal for tournament play, even when sleeved. Damaged condition cards have massive border wear, possible writing or major inking (ex. white-bordered cards with black-markered front borders), massive corner wear, prevalent scratching, folds, creases or tears.
